Best Deer Trail Public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public schools serving 361 students in Deer Trail, CO.
The top-ranked public schools in Deer Trail, CO are Deer Trail Elementary School and Deer Trail Junior-senior High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Deer Trail, CO public schools have an average math proficiency score of 19% (versus the Colorado public school average of 33%), and reading proficiency score of 17% (versus the 45% statewide average). Schools in Deer Trail have an average ranking of 1/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Colorado public schools.
Minority enrollment is 53%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Colorado public school average of 50% (majority Hispanic).
